This is just as he disclosed that the committee is also investigating the allegations levelled against the new NIA boss, Ahmed Rufai Abubakar.
Honourable Jaji while fielding question from newsmen in Abuja spoke on the committee’s effort in investigating the agency.
According to him, “the most important thing is that there was $ 289 million approved by the agency. Then $43 million was discovered in Ikoyi, and another $44 million was discovered in their vault. If they procured or whatever they did, from there we can say they procured this and did this for so and so projects”.
On the $44 million that was reported missing in the agency’s vault, Honourable Jaji said that We later discovered from our meeting since last week that the $44m is not missing. For that one, I can tell you they moved the money from one place to another.
“We are still investigating. If we get 60 to 70 percent of what we are supposed to get, then we can tell you. But for now, I will tell you categorically that the money is not missing. They only moved it from the agency to another place pending when all these issues surrounding the agency are resolved”, he stated.
He further stated that “If you remember, this $44 million is part of the $289 million approved to the then DG, Ayo Oke. You know that in April last year, there was the issue of $43m found in Ikoyi. He tried to say that the $44m and the $43m are part of the $289m. But for us, we’re still working to see where the remaining $202m was placed. We only know about the $43m recovered in Ikoyi and the $44m recovered from their vault.
“In the course of our investigation, we’ll come up with where the $289m really is, not the $43m and not the $44m but the entire amount”, he stated.
On the new NIA boss, he said that ” there’s an investigation going on before the committee. We started the investigation last week. In the course of the investigation, we invited the immediate past acting DG of NIA. After that, we resolved to invite the present DG, NIA.
“Having interacted with him, we found out that already there are allegations against him in the social media, about his person and what have you. By and large, the issue of saying there are some directors in the agency that are protesting the appointment, as the chairman, we didn’t receive any information in this regard.
“We tried to find out from the DG and some staff working in the agency, and there’s no protest. For me, it’s just something anonymous, so there’s none”, he disclosed.
